?? 利用定時器實現燈的閃爍(-).asm
字號:
ORG 0000H
AJMP START
ORG 30H
START: MOV P0,#0FFH ;關閉所有的燈
MOV TMOD,#00000001B ;定時/計數器0工作于方式1
MOV TH0,#15H
MOV TL0,#0A0H ;以上兩行預置計數5336(15A0H)
SETB TR0 ;定時/計數器0開始運行
LOOP: JBC TF0,NEXT ;如果TF0等于1,則將TF0清0并轉next處
AJMP LOOP ;否則跳轉到LOOP處運行
NEXT: CPL P0.0 ;點亮P0.0燈
MOV TH0,#15H ;
MOV TL0,#0A0H ;重置定時/計數器的初值
AJMP LOOP
END
?? 快捷鍵說明
復制代碼
Ctrl + C
搜索代碼
Ctrl + F
全屏模式
F11
切換主題
Ctrl + Shift + D
顯示快捷鍵
?
增大字號
Ctrl + =
減小字號
Ctrl + -